Unlock instant, AI-driven research and patent intelligence for your innovation.

Foreground program allocating system and realizing method

A technology of foreground program and implementation method, which is applied in the directions of multi-programming device and resource allocation, and can solve the problems of high response of foreground program and so on.

Inactive Publication Date: 2012-07-11
上海宁乐科技有限公司
View PDF2 Cites 12 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Under the same priority, each process can obtain relatively average computer resources, but some foreground programs require a relatively high response. Once the system cannot satisfy the response of some foreground programs, a prompt of "the program is not responding" will appear immediately

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Foreground program allocating system and realizing method
  • Foreground program allocating system and realizing method
  • Foreground program allocating system and realizing method

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0026] The deployment system of the foreground program of the present invention is pre-set according to the program, and is carried out by intervening in the resource scheduling of the Windows operating system. The system includes:

[0027] The information collection module is used to complete the collection of process information, and store the collected process information into a process information base; wherein, the process information includes: process information that occupies CPU, network and memory resources; the process information base is set on the In the information collection module;

[0028] The basic function module is used to provide the basic functions used by the resource allocation module to limit system resources, and is directly called by the resource allocation module; the basic function module provides the basic functions of specifically limiting CPU usage, limiting network usage and memory usage, but The specific restriction is determined by the resourc...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a foreground program allocating system and realizing method. The system comprises an information collection module, a basic function module, and a resource allocation module. The realizing method comprises (1) using the information collection module to start collecting progress information, classifying and sorting the information, and storing the information into a progress information database; and (2) using the resource allocation module to read the progress information in the progress information database and generate a corresponding strategy, and using the function provided by the basic function module to accomplish foreground program allocation to achieve resource balance. The invention can realize rapid response of the foreground program and avoid no response from program.

Description

technical field [0001] The invention relates to a computer resource allocation system and method, in particular to a foreground program allocation system and implementation method. Background technique [0002] With the explosive growth of software, programs are now resident in the user's memory. Since the increasing number of processes uses limited computer resources, it will inevitably make the user experience that the machine is getting "slower" (or "stuck"). [0003] Since the thread scheduling strategy of the Windows operating system itself is a relatively fair scheduling strategy. Under the same priority, each process can obtain relatively average computer resources, but some foreground programs require a relatively high response. Once the system cannot meet the response of some foreground programs, a prompt "The program is not responding" will appear immediately. Contents of the invention [0004] The technical problem to be solved by the present invention is to p...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F9/50
Inventor 刘海平白宁
Owner 上海宁乐科技有限公司